Spicy Jalapeño Popper Soup With Grilled Cheese Dippers
This rich creamy and spicy soup takes all the flavor of jalapeño poppers and transforms it into a comforting bowl of warmth Topped with crispy bacon and served with golden grilled cheese dippers it delivers cheesy smoky heat in every bite Perfect for cold nights game days or whenever you crave something indulgent and soul satisfying
Time Required
Prep Time 15 minutes
Cook Time 30 minutes
Total Time 45 minutes
Ingredients
For the Soup
4 slices beef chopped
1 tablespoon butter
1 small onion diced
3 to 4 jalapeños seeded and diced
2 cloves garlic minced
2 tablespoons all-purpose flour
3 cups chicken broth
1 cup milk
1 cup heavy cream
1 block cream cheese softened
1 cup shredded cheddar cheese
Salt and pepper to taste
Optional toppings sliced jalapeños extra cheese crumbled bacon
For the Grilled Cheese Dippers
4 slices bread
1 cup shredded cheddar or cheese of choice
1 to 2 tablespoons butter softened
Instructions
Cook the beef in a large pot over medium heat until crisp Remove and set aside leaving about 1 tablespoon of beef fat in the pot
Add butter onion and jalapeños Cook for 4 to 5 minutes until soft
Add garlic and cook for 1 minute
Sprinkle in flour and stir continuously for 1 to 2 minutes to create a roux
Slowly pour in chicken broth milk and cream Stir well and bring to a gentle simmer
Add cream cheese and stir until completely melted and smooth
Stir in cheddar cheese until melted and fully blended into the soup
Season with salt and pepper Add cooked bacon back in or reserve for topping
Keep warm on low heat while making grilled cheese dippers
For the Grilled Cheese Dippers
Butter one side of each slice of bread
Place cheese between two slices buttered side out
Cook on a skillet over medium heat until golden brown and cheese is melted about 3 minutes per side
Cut into strips for dipping
Tips
Use gloves when handling jalapeños to avoid skin irritation
For less heat remove all seeds and white membranes from the jalapeños
Soften cream cheese before adding to prevent clumps
Stir soup constantly after adding cheese to keep it smooth and creamy
Use a hand blender for a smoother texture if desired but keep some chunks for classic popper style
Toast the grilled cheese slowly on low to medium heat for extra meltiness
Variations
Swap cheddar for pepper jack mozzarella or gouda for different flavor profiles
Add shredded chicken to the soup for extra protein
Use turkey beef for a lighter version
Make it vegetarian by skipping the beef and using veggie broth
Add corn or black beans for a Tex Mex twist
Use sourdough or rye bread for heartier grilled cheese dippers
Spice it up more with cayenne chili flakes or hot sauce stirred into the soup
Q&A
Q Can I make this soup ahead of time?
A Yes you can store it in the fridge for up to three days Reheat gently and stir well before serving
Q Can I freeze the soup?
A It is best fresh because of the dairy content but you can freeze it in an airtight container for up to one month Stir well when reheating
Q Is this soup very spicy?
A It has a medium kick but you can adjust the spice level by using more or fewer jalapeños or leaving in the seeds for extra heat
Q Can I use low fat ingredients?
A Yes you can use low fat cream cheese and milk but the soup will be slightly thinner
